Markel (MKL) Income from Non-Controlling Interests (2016 - 2025)
Markel (MKL) has disclosed Income from Non-Controlling Interests for 17 consecutive years, with $5.3 million as the latest value for Q4 2025.
- Quarterly Income from Non-Controlling Interests fell 56.62% to $5.3 million in Q4 2025 from the year-ago period, while the trailing twelve-month figure was $45.4 million through Dec 2025, down 54.8% year-over-year, with the annual reading at $45.4 million for FY2025, 54.78% down from the prior year.
- Income from Non-Controlling Interests for Q4 2025 was $5.3 million at Markel, down from $12.5 million in the prior quarter.
- The five-year high for Income from Non-Controlling Interests was $57.1 million in Q3 2022, with the low at $1.6 million in Q3 2021.
- Average Income from Non-Controlling Interests over 5 years is $19.3 million, with a median of $16.2 million recorded in 2022.
